The Ultimate Smoky Eyes

Not only are these compact eyeshadow sets cute and affordable, but they also create the perfect smoky eye, with each shade labelled with the appropriate place to sweep on the lid. I decided to buy two of these in the shades "Smoky" and "Beautiful Browns", as blues suit me as I have blue eyes and browns suit me as they're quite neutral shades. At £2.50 each, you might as well give them a go!


As you can see, there is an easy guide to tell you where to place the shadow. The cream coloured base colour is a lovely undertone and helps brighten the eyes. The light brown shade that follows is perfect to place all over the lid up to the crease. The third shade is a rich, chocolate bronze colour with a hint of shimmer, which gives the eyes a nice sparkle and the final darker brown shade helps define the eye, giving an overall gorgeous brown smoky look.




This is my favourite one and I love wearing this mini palette on a night out. Filled with whites, greys and dark blues, it's perfect for creating the ultimate smoky eye and makes your eyes pop! I especially recommend this if you have blue eyes like myself, as they really bring out the colour. Last time I wore these eyeshadows, they stayed on all night (with the help of eyelid primer beforehand).

My New Favourite Perfume

I received this perfume for Christmas and I was very grateful as I love Next perfumes! I've previously owned 'Diamonds' and 'Gold' and I have to say that they are extremely underrated. I received the 100ml version of 'Sparkle' from my parents and it also came with a body lotion in the exact same scent, which has a slight shimmer to it that I absolutely love!

I also love the bottle, as it looks really pretty with the rest of my perfumes. If you purchase the perfume on its own, it retails at £12, which is a good price as it's 100ml! I would describe the scent as being quite sophisticated (ooh, get me!) and distinctive, as it has citrus and floral notes. The scent also lingers for quite a while, which is always a positive!


I recommend giving Next perfumes a go if you haven't already, or buying them as gifts for people! They aren't too pricey, plus there is a variety to choose from and test in the shop.
